April 8, 2026

Kuwait’s interior ministry reported “severe material damage” at several vital facilities of the Kuwait Petroleum Corporation and the energy and water resources ministry after an Iranian drone attack on Wednesday.

The ministry said fires broke out in some of the attacked sites, which it said include oil facilities and three power stations and water desalination plants.
